Quote from CBS regarding HOH comp:

CAN'T STAND THE HEAT? GET OUT OF THE COOKER
Spoiler
is home and ready to resume the game, preparing for "pressure cooker," this week's "stressful" HoH Competition. In an oversized plastic pressure cooker in the backyard, each housemate has to choose one of the nine buttons in the cooker and hold it down as long for as possible. The aim of the game is endurance. There are no food, drink or toilet breaks, and the door will only open when three people have let go of their buttons, allowing these people to leave the game. The door will not open again until another three people have released their buttons. The last HouseGuest still holding down their button after everyone else has quit is the new HoH. There is an added twist though: each time a person lets go of their button, they have to open one of the nine boxes in the center of the "pressure cooker." Inside the boxes are surprises for the HouseGuests. Some of the surprises are good and some not.
